Price and efficiency are key factors when choosing a car – and this is often where the real differences emerge.
Audi A5 Sportback has a evident advantage in terms of price – it starts at 38700 £ , while the Mercedes E Class costs 50500 £ . That’s a price difference of around 11748 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: Mercedes E Class manages with 1.50 L and is therefore clearly perceptible more efficient than the Audi A5 Sportback with 2 L. The difference is about 0.50 L per 100 km.
As for electric range, the Mercedes E Class performs hardly perceptible better – achieving up to 116 km, about 6 km more than the Audi A5 Sportback.
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.
When it comes to engine power, the Mercedes E Class has a noticeable edge – offering 585 HP compared to 367 HP. That’s roughly 218 HP more horsepower.
In ac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h, the Mercedes E Class is a bit quicker – completing the sprint in 4 s, while the Audi A5 Sportback takes 4.50 s. That’s about 0.50 s faster.
There’s no difference in top speed – both reach 250 km/h.
There’s also a difference in torque: Mercedes E Class pulls clearly perceptible stronger with 750 Nm compared to 550 Nm. That’s about 200 Nm difference.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Seats: Mercedes E Class offers somewhat more seating capacity – 5 vs 4.
In curb weight, Audi A5 Sportback is minimal lighter – 1770 kg compared to 1810 kg. The difference is around 40 kg.
In terms of boot space, the Mercedes E Class offers to a small extent more room – 540 L compared to 445 L. That’s a difference of about 95 L.
When it comes to payload, Mercedes E Class somewhat takes the win – 640 kg compared to 530 kg. That’s a difference of about 110 kg.
